What are types of current?

There are two kinds of current electricity: direct current (DC) and alternating current (AC). With direct current, electrons move in one direction. Batteries produce direct current. In alternating current, electrons flow in both directions.

What causes power failure?

Natural phenomena such as wind, lightning, freezing rain, iced-up lines, wildlife and snow cause the majority of power failures. Tree branches coming into contact with power lines can also cause an outage.

What is an electric current formula?

The current is the ratio of the potential difference and the resistance. It is represented as (I). The current formula is given as I = V/R. The SI unit of current is Ampere (Amp).

Why is power loss due to current and not voltage?

Voltage does not flow. It pushes the current. Cables have resistance (unfortunately) and current flowing through a resistance causes heat in a cable which is a power loss. The current produces a voltage drop along the length of the cable.
